Description
Dimethylaminophenyl(Methyl)Borane is an organoboron compound featuring a dimethylamino-substituted phenyl ring, which is of significant interest in advanced synthetic chemistry. This compound matters as a versatile building block and reagent, particularly valued for its role in cross-coupling reactions and as a precursor to more complex boron-containing molecules. It is primarily needed by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and materials science industries for creating novel chemical entities and functional materials.
Application
- Suzuki-Miyaura Cross-Coupling Reactions: Acts as a key organoboron reagent for forming carbon-carbon bonds in the synthesis of complex organic molecules.
- Pharmaceutical Intermediate: Serves as a crucial building block in the research and development of new active pharmaceutical ingredients (APIs).
- Agrochemical Synthesis: Used in the creation of novel herbicides, fungicides, and insecticides requiring specific boron-functionalized intermediates.
- Materials Science Research: Employed in the development of organic electronic materials, such as OLEDs and organic semiconductors.
- Ligand and Catalyst Preparation: Functions as a precursor for synthesizing specialized ligands and catalysts used in homogeneous catalysis.
- Academic and Industrial R&D: A valuable tool for methodological development and exploring new synthetic pathways in chemistry laboratories.
Basic Information
| Product Name | Dimethylaminophenyl(Methyl)Borane |
| CAS No. | 3519-71-9 |
| Molecular Formula | C9H14BN |
| Molecular Weight | 147.03 g/mol |
| Synonyms | (Dimethylaminophenyl)methylborane; N,N-Dimethyl-4-(methylboranyl)aniline; B-Methyl-B-(4-(dimethylamino)phenyl)borane; 4-(Dimethylamino)phenylmethylborane; (4-(Dimethylamino)phenyl)methylborane; p-(Dimethylamino)phenylmethylborane; Borane, methyl[4-(dimethylamino)phenyl]- |

Storage
Preserve in a tightly closed container, protected from light. Store under an inert atmosphere (e.g., nitrogen or argon) at controlled room temperature (15-25°C) in a cool, dry, and well-ventilated area. This compound is easily oxidized and must be handled with care to exclude air and moisture.
